aboutsummaryrefslogtreecommitdiffstats
path: root/java/org/gnu
diff options
context:
space:
mode:
authorDmitry Gutov2024-08-25 18:23:51 +0300
committerDmitry Gutov2024-08-25 18:23:51 +0300
commit713069dd7a87cff8388c25f1bc2c2c1b5217b1ca (patch)
tree24834f22583d6c7c7b8c3b4fcb42cc99cdc6175c /java/org/gnu
parent096730510cdf8c582972f68afeef3226ee5810ca (diff)
downloademacs-713069dd7a87cff8388c25f1bc2c2c1b5217b1ca.tar.gz
emacs-713069dd7a87cff8388c25f1bc2c2c1b5217b1ca.zip
[Eglot] Stricter "expand common" behavior
* lisp/progmodes/eglot.el (eglot--dumb-tryc): Check that the expanded string matches every completion strictly (bug#72705). And in the fallback case, check whether the table matches the original prefix at all. Return nil otherwise. * test/lisp/progmodes/eglot-tests.el (eglot-test-stop-completion-on-nonprefix) (eglot-test-try-completion-nomatch): Corresponding tests. * etc/EGLOT-NEWS: New entry.
Diffstat (limited to 'java/org/gnu')
0 files changed, 0 insertions, 0 deletions